  1. /*
  2. * CMapFormatTest.cpp, part of VCMI engine
  3. *
  4. * Authors: listed in file AUTHORS in main folder
  5. *
  6. * License: GNU General Public License v2.0 or later
  7. * Full text of license available in license.txt file, in main folder
  8. *
  9. */
  10. #include "StdInc.h"
  11. #include <boost/test/unit_test.hpp>
  12. #include "../lib/filesystem/CMemoryBuffer.h"
  13. #include "../lib/filesystem/Filesystem.h"
  14. #include "../lib/mapping/CMap.h"
  15. #include "../lib/rmg/CMapGenOptions.h"
  16. #include "../lib/rmg/CMapGenerator.h"
  17. #include "../lib/mapping/MapFormatJson.h"
  18. #include "../lib/VCMIDirs.h"
  19. #include "MapComparer.h"
  20. static const int TEST_RANDOM_SEED = 1337;
  21. BOOST_AUTO_TEST_CASE(MapFormat_Random)
  22. {
  23. logGlobal->info("MapFormat_Random start");
  24. BOOST_TEST_CHECKPOINT("MapFormat_Random start");
  25. std::unique_ptr<CMap> initialMap;
  26. CMapGenOptions opt;
  27. opt.setHeight(CMapHeader::MAP_SIZE_MIDDLE);
  28. opt.setWidth(CMapHeader::MAP_SIZE_MIDDLE);
  29. opt.setHasTwoLevels(true);
  30. opt.setPlayerCount(4);
  31. opt.setPlayerTypeForStandardPlayer(PlayerColor(0), EPlayerType::HUMAN);
  32. opt.setPlayerTypeForStandardPlayer(PlayerColor(1), EPlayerType::AI);
  33. opt.setPlayerTypeForStandardPlayer(PlayerColor(2), EPlayerType::AI);
  34. opt.setPlayerTypeForStandardPlayer(PlayerColor(3), EPlayerType::AI);
  35. CMapGenerator gen;
  36. initialMap = gen.generate(&opt, TEST_RANDOM_SEED);
  37. initialMap->name = "Test";
  38. BOOST_TEST_CHECKPOINT("MapFormat_Random generated");
  39. CMemoryBuffer serializeBuffer;
  40. {
  41. CMapSaverJson saver(&serializeBuffer);
  42. saver.saveMap(initialMap);
  43. }
  44. BOOST_TEST_CHECKPOINT("MapFormat_Random serialized");
  45. #if 1
  46. {
  47. auto path = VCMIDirs::get().userDataPath()/"test_random.vmap";
  48. boost::filesystem::remove(path);
  49. boost::filesystem::ofstream tmp(path, boost::filesystem::ofstream::binary);
  50. tmp.write((const char *)serializeBuffer.getBuffer().data(),serializeBuffer.getSize());
  51. tmp.flush();
  52. tmp.close();
  53. logGlobal->info("Test map has been saved to:");
  54. logGlobal->info(path.string());
  55. }
  56. BOOST_TEST_CHECKPOINT("MapFormat_Random saved");
  57. #endif // 1
  58. serializeBuffer.seek(0);
  59. {
  60. CMapLoaderJson loader(&serializeBuffer);
  61. std::unique_ptr<CMap> serialized = loader.loadMap();
  62. MapComparer c;
  63. c(serialized, initialMap);
  64. }
  65. logGlobal->info("MapFormat_Random finish");
  66. }
  67. static JsonNode getFromArchive(CZipLoader & archive, const std::string & archiveFilename)
  68. {
  69. ResourceID resource(archiveFilename, EResType::TEXT);
  70. if(!archive.existsResource(resource))
  71. throw new std::runtime_error(archiveFilename+" not found");
  72. auto data = archive.load(resource)->readAll();
  73. JsonNode res(reinterpret_cast<char*>(data.first.get()), data.second);
  74. return std::move(res);
  75. }
  76. static void addToArchive(CZipSaver & saver, const JsonNode & data, const std::string & filename)
  77. {
  78. std::ostringstream out;
  79. out << data;
  80. out.flush();
  81. {
  82. auto s = out.str();
  83. std::unique_ptr<COutputStream> stream = saver.addFile(filename);
  84. if(stream->write((const ui8*)s.c_str(), s.size()) != s.size())
  85. throw new std::runtime_error("CMapSaverJson::saveHeader() zip compression failed.");
  86. }
  87. }
  88. BOOST_AUTO_TEST_CASE(MapFormat_Objects)
  89. {
  90. logGlobal->info("MapFormat_Objects start");
  91. static const std::string MAP_DATA_PATH = "test/ObjectPropertyTest/";
  92. const JsonNode initialHeader(ResourceID(MAP_DATA_PATH+"header.json"));
  93. const JsonNode expectedHeader(ResourceID(MAP_DATA_PATH+"header.json"));//same as initial for now
  94. const JsonNode initialObjects(ResourceID(MAP_DATA_PATH+"objects.json"));
  95. const JsonNode expectedObjects(ResourceID(MAP_DATA_PATH+"objects.ex.json"));
  96. const JsonNode expectedSurface(ResourceID(MAP_DATA_PATH+"surface_terrain.json"));
  97. const JsonNode expectedUnderground(ResourceID(MAP_DATA_PATH+"underground_terrain.json"));
  98. std::unique_ptr<CMap> originalMap;
  99. {
  100. CMemoryBuffer initialBuffer;
  101. std::shared_ptr<CIOApi> originalDataIO(new CProxyIOApi(&initialBuffer));
  102. {
  103. CZipSaver initialSaver(originalDataIO, "_");
  104. addToArchive(initialSaver, initialHeader, "header.json");
  105. addToArchive(initialSaver, initialObjects, "objects.json");
  106. addToArchive(initialSaver, expectedSurface, "surface_terrain.json");
  107. addToArchive(initialSaver, expectedUnderground, "underground_terrain.json");
  108. }
  109. initialBuffer.seek(0);
  110. {
  111. CMapLoaderJson initialLoader(&initialBuffer);
  112. originalMap = initialLoader.loadMap();
  113. }
  114. }
  115. CMemoryBuffer serializeBuffer;
  116. {
  117. CMapSaverJson saver(&serializeBuffer);
  118. saver.saveMap(originalMap);
  119. }
  120. std::shared_ptr<CIOApi> actualDataIO(new CProxyROIOApi(&serializeBuffer));
  121. CZipLoader actualDataLoader("", "_", actualDataIO);
  122. const JsonNode actualHeader = getFromArchive(actualDataLoader, "header.json");
  123. const JsonNode actualObjects = getFromArchive(actualDataLoader, "objects.json");
  124. const JsonNode actualSurface = getFromArchive(actualDataLoader, "surface_terrain.json");
  125. const JsonNode actualUnderground = getFromArchive(actualDataLoader, "underground_terrain.json");
  126. {
  127. auto path = VCMIDirs::get().userDataPath()/"test_object_property.vmap";
  128. boost::filesystem::remove(path);
  129. boost::filesystem::ofstream tmp(path, boost::filesystem::ofstream::binary);
  130. tmp.write((const char *)serializeBuffer.getBuffer().data(),serializeBuffer.getSize());
  131. tmp.flush();
  132. tmp.close();
  133. logGlobal->infoStream() << "Test map has been saved to " << path;
  134. }
  135. {
  136. JsonMapComparer c;
  137. c.compareHeader(actualHeader, expectedHeader);
  138. }
  139. {
  140. JsonMapComparer c;
  141. c.compareObjects(actualObjects, expectedObjects);
  142. }
  143. {
  144. JsonMapComparer c;
  145. c.compareTerrain("surface", actualSurface, expectedSurface);
  146. }
  147. {
  148. JsonMapComparer c;
  149. c.compareTerrain("underground", actualUnderground, expectedUnderground);
  150. }
  151. logGlobal->info("MapFormat_Objects finish");
  152. }
